In the current year, 14 new sports facilities are planned to be built in Tatarstan. This was recalled by the Minister of Construction, Architecture and Housing and Communal Services of the Republic of Tatarstan, Marat Aizatullin, at a traditional meeting held at the Government House of the Republic of Tatarstan.
The meeting was conducted via videoconference with all municipal districts by the Rais of Tatarstan, Rustam Minnikhanov.
Construction of four indoor football arenas in the Leninsk, Alekseevsk, Drozhzhanovsky, and Tyulyachinsky districts has reached 14% of the total volume.
Out of six universal sports площадки, contractors have started work in the Drozhzhanovsky and Mendeleevsky districts. The overall completion is estimated at 3%. Work on the remaining facilities will begin in the first half of May.
Construction of three ice arenas has reached 18%.
The readiness of the largest sports facility — the Football Development Center in Kazan — has reached 71%.
